diff --git a/addon.xml b/addon.xml
index 9af46f4d8284f46d99793d21e67649a08aa8fd97..143d7e5822904f11a8876e826b5657bea732c920 100644
--- a/addon.xml
+++ b/addon.xml
@@ -1,7 +1,7 @@
 <?xml version="1.0" encoding="UTF-8" standalone="yes"?>
 <addon id="script.spotify.screensaver"
     name="Spotify Screensaver"
-    version="0.0.9"
+    version="0.0.10"
     provider-name="BenoƮt Harrault">
     <requires>
         <import addon="xbmc.python" version="2.25.0"/>
diff --git a/gui.py b/gui.py
index a4e2cc2842f6c31b1c62462a825adc5f1d00aa27..3722bbb821fccb465d41e3b5dd75cc6047a44b63 100644
--- a/gui.py
+++ b/gui.py
@@ -129,9 +129,18 @@ class GUI(xbmcgui.WindowXMLDialog):
         ):
             self._remove_images()
             self.next = True
+        elif event_type == 'volume_set':
+            self._unimplemented_event_type(event_type, event_value)
         else:
             self.log('unknown event type: ' + event_type, xbmc.LOGERROR)
 
+    def _unimplemented_event_type(self, event_type, event_value):
+        self.log(
+            'unimplemented event type: ' + str(event_type)
+            + ' (value: ' + str(event_value) + ')',
+            xbmc.LOGDEBUG
+        )
+
     def _preload_images(self, track_id):
         self.log('preload images for track: ' + track_id, xbmc.LOGERROR)
         self._get_track_data(track_id)